Sincronización de la producción en el área de rectificado laminación en frío

Abstract

Este proyecto de tesis viene a complementar una de las estrategias de negocio de la empresa IMSA MEX S.A. de C.V (División APM), a quién en lo sucesivo se le llamará APM. Donde uno de sus objetivos es el de incrementar su participación de mercado en la lámina RFR (Rollo Rolado en Frío), para lograr lo anterior se necesitan desarrollar proyectos que ayuden a aumentar la capacidad productiva de uno de sus procesos críticos (Molino Tándem Frío). Con la finalidad de lograr lo anterior esta tesis se desarrolla mediante la implementación de un sistema "pull system", el cual permita la sincronización de la producción del área de rectificado de laminación en frío con los requerimientos del Molino Tándem. Con este sistema se busca eliminar las demoras por falta de rodillos generadas en el Molino a causa de un problema de sincronización. Lo que se espera lograr al implementar el sistema de trabajo (Pull System) es lo siguiente: - Incremento de Capacidad Productiva del Molino Tándem Frío - Eliminar las demoras por falta de rodillos en el Molino Tándem Frío - Coordinar el proceso de rectificado con las necesidades de sus cliente internos. - Potencial incremento en la participación de mercado en el segmento de lámina RFR (Rollo Rolado en Frío)
